Guest Victor von Zeppelin Posted March 24, 2011 Report Posted March 24, 2011 My wildfire (which also had an ARMv6 processor) was overclocked to 729mhz. It was perfectly stable. I haven't had a single freeze or reboot in over 24 hours so I'm assuming it's pretty stable. Battery life seems decent too using the smartass governor. What CPU speeds are generally considered safe? There isn't "safe", no two CPUs are identical. And just because the Wildfire's CPU was ARMv6, doesn't mean it was anywhere near the same. "Safe" is the point at which things don't crash and don't overheat on YOUR phone. It doesn't matter if someone can overclock to 800MHz, if you can only to 620 or so, that's what you have to live with.
